About this walk

A beautifully spend few hours. the trail takes you around a large forest area, parts are pretty hilly. when it rains it can get muddy. so bring those welly boots! there is a little view tower when you reach the top. beautiful. the dogs loved it. plenty of running around and chasing sticks.
